Veteran actress, Rita Edochie has reacted after the Court of Appeal sitting in Abuja discharged and acquitted the leader of the Indigenous People of Biafra (IPOB),ย Nnamdi Kanu.

OsunDaily News ย had earlier reported that the Court of Appeal on Thursday,ย struck out charges levelled against himย by the Federal Government.

The Court of Appeal ruled that the Federal Government breached all local and international laws in the forceful rendition of Kanu to Nigeria, thereby making the terrorism charges against him incompetent and unlawful.

Reacting to the development, the veteran actress, who has never hidden her support for the secessionist group, in an Instagram post on Friday shared the good news with her followers.

She also shared a striking photo of herself and the IPOB leader with the caption: โ€œONE WITH CHUKWU OKIKE ABIAMA IS MAJORITY. NO MATTER WHAT YOU FEEL OR THINK THE TRUTH IS OUT AND HE IS FREE. DAALU CHUKWU OKIKE ABIAMA THAT AT LAST MAZI NNAMDI OKWU KANU IS FREE, DISCHARGED AND ACQUITTED. I AM HAPPY AND EXCITED NOW. NNOOOOOO NNAM. ALSO A BIG THANKS TO ALL THE PEOPLE THAT MADE IT POSSIBLE LIKE MAZI IFEANYI EJIOFOR AND OTHERS.โ€
